The U.S.S. Enterprise NCC-1701-D, a Galaxy-class vessel commissioned in
2363, is the fifth Starfleet ship to carry the famous name enterprise.
Commanded by Captain Jean-Luc Picard, the Enterprise is known as the
flagship of Starfleet. During its span of service it distinguishes itself
in an array of missions, but is ultimately destroyed in an operation to
prevent the destruction of the Veridian System.
The primary role of the Enterprise is to explore deep space, and
carry out diplomatic assignments for the United Federation 0f Planets. The
Enterprise runs into trouble with its very first mission, to investigate
the possibility of using Farpoint Station as a Federation base. Q
sentences the entire human race to death, but Picard negotiates for their
lives by promising to demonstrate humanity's progress during the mission
to Farpoint Station. The crew is successful in this, but it isn't the last
time that the Enterprise hosts Q.
The Enterprise is ever evolving during its time as the flagship of
Starfleet. When the ship visits Star base 74 for a computer upgrade to be
performed by a race of computer specialists, the Bynars, its capability as
a huge mobile memory core is the attraction. The Bynars' home world
computer is threatened by a nearby nova, and they hijack the Enterprise
with the hope of downloading their heritage. They are too late, and nearly
die for their cause, but the crew uses the Ship's computer to rejuvenate
the misguided Bynars and return them to Star base 74.
The
Enterprise under goes extensive repairs after the Borg attack on the
Starfleet Armada. Not all of the repairs are effective. An explosion in
the Enterprise's dilithium chamber begins a trail of intrigue that
eventually even implicates Captain Picard.
Dr.
Leah Brahms, the Galaxy class engine designer, is initially unhappy with
the changes that Chief Engineer Geordi La Forge makes to her original
designs. But she comes to appreciate that the circumstances of Enterprise
missions sometimes call for solutions that are not by the book.
Many experiments to expand scientific understanding of the Galaxy
and the capabilities of space travel are held aboard the Enterprise. An
early one nearly destroys the ship when it plunges into a neighboring
galaxy with the help of The Traveler, a Starfleet consultant. When another
experiment conducted by Dr. Paul Stubbs - involving the stellar explosion
of a neutron super giant binary - is threatened by Wesley Crusher's
science project, Wesley allows two medical micro biotic 'nanites' to
interact, and they begin to 'eat' the ship's computer core. The nanites
are attacked by Dr. Stubbs, but prove their sentience by shutting down the
ship's life support system. Eventually, Dr. Stubbs apologizes to them
through Data and they return the ship to its original condition in time to complete
the experiment.
